Three safety tips :-

1. Think before posting anything :- Sharing intimate details or personal problems can cause you a lot of problems if your partner becomes your ex and share them on social media.This tip is in my list because this type of thing is happening with a lot of youngsters.

2. Don't compare your life with others social media posts :- People mostly share their happy photos and lavish stories and skip their struggles and bad moments.Never let this ruin your day.This tip is in my list because everybody wants to live like others and become successful overnight.

3. Passwords are private :- Never share your passwords or bank details on random sites or on phone calls,you can become a victim of cyber attacks.This safety tip is in my list because internet crimes are increasing everyday exponentially.
